Video: Sharjah ruler announces salary hike for non-Emirati employees

Dh600 million increase in the salaries of the emirate's government employees was implemented on January 1, 2018.

 

The salaries of non-Emirati Sharjah government employees will also be hiked by 10 per cent retroactively from the start of January this year. This comes following directions of His Highness Dr Sheikh Sultan bin Mohammed Al Qasimi, Member of the Supreme Council and Ruler of Sharjah, on Saturday.

In a video, His Highness said that he wanted to increase salaries of all employees in Sharjah government in the beginning of 2018. He issued directions for pay hike of Emirati staff. Now, he has directed salary raise for the non-Emirati employees, while appreciating their loyalty.

His Highness had ordered a Dh600 million increase in the salaries of the emirate's government employees which was implemented on January 1, 2018, for only Emirati nationals, who shall no more be categorized below the 8th grade.
